How does it work?
As a shipping agent or freight forwarder, you report hdangerous and polluting goods to the Harbour Master's Office via an electronic IFTDGN message. They draw on this to compile a safety file.
That IFTDGN message contains all the information about the dangerous and polluting cargo you are bringing to the terminal. You send that notification at least 24 hours before the arrival of the goods.
- The shipping agent sends the message on import or remain on board
- The freight forwarder sends the message when the goods are exported
For the exact departure of dangerous and polluting goods from the terminal, the terminal operator uses specific terminal messages, such as ‘CODECO’ and ‘COARRI’.
